A Method of DDoS Attack Detection and Mitigation for the Comprehensive Coordinated Protection of SDN Controllers

Abstract: Software defined networking (SDN) improves the flexibility and programmability of the network by separating the control plane and the data plane and effectively realizes the global control of the network infrastructure. However, the centralized structure design of SDN exposes the controller to potential threats.
